Mudireddipalle
Mudireddipalle is a village located in Kosgi mandal of Mahbubnagar district in Telangana, India. It is situated 9km away from sub-district headquarter Kosgi (tehsildar office) and 55km away from district headquarter Mahbubnagar. As per 2009 stats, Mudireddipalle village is also a gram panchayat.

About Mudireddipalle
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Mudireddipalle is 574968. The village spans a total geographical area of 492 hectares. Tandur is nearest town to Mudireddipalle village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 46km away.

Population of Mudireddipalle
Below is a concise population overview of Mudireddipalle as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,337 | 685 | 652 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 213 | 107 | 106 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 309 | 169 | 140 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 481 | 247 | 234 |
Literate Population | 475 | 287 | 188 |
Illiterate Population | 862 | 398 | 464 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Mudireddipalle village:
- The total population of Mudireddipalle village is around 1,337, including approximately 685 males and 652 females, with a sex ratio of 951 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 213 children aged 0–6 years in Mudireddipalle village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Mudireddipalle village has 309 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 481 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Mudireddipalle village is about 35.53%, with male literacy at 41.90% and female literacy at 28.83%.
- There are around 247 households in Mudireddipalle village.
Connectivity of Mudireddipalle
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Mudireddipalle. As per the 2011 stats, Mudireddipalle had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
